Enter Strategic Partnership Move Promotes Universal National Standard for Broker Approval WEST HILLS, Calif. and SEATTLE, Jan. 19 /PRNewswire/ -- Affinity Corporation and LION Inc. (OTC Bulletin Board: LINC), the parent company of Lioninc.com, are bringing the mortgage industry a step closer to a universal national standard for broker approval by wholesale lenders. The two companies, both leaders in their respective industries, announced today a strategic partnership to facilitate online broker certification services for the mortgage industry. In forming this partnership, both companies will enhance each other's products. Lioninc.com will add Affinity's Third Party Originator (TPO) Certification Program to its web site (www.lioninc.com). This online tool will provide LION's member brokers with an efficient and economical means to become approved by lenders. Brokers will be able to download and fill out the TPO Certification Application, attach documents and submit it to Affinity with a one-time enrollment fee. Affinity will review the file, pull the credit report, certify the package as complete and assign the broker a universal nine-digit number (U-9). Lioninc.com's web site will feature Affinity's U-9 numbering system. Brokers will be able to submit the U-9 number to Lioninc.com's lenders without having to include lengthy applications with loan originations. U-9 numbers also can be provided instead of having to fill out annual lender update forms. "This partnership will be of tremendous benefit to our member brokers and lenders," said David Stedman, Lioninc.com's COO. "It will further diversify Lioninc.com's services by providing our brokers with a standardized approval process and our lenders with cost reductions associated with approving and managing mortgage brokers." Affinity will add Lioninc.com's URL to its EnGarde(TM) software browser. EnGarde(TM) users will have the ability to access Lioninc.com without leaving the program. "The online union of Affinity and Lioninc.com will help streamline the broker approval and loan origination process by dramatically reducing time and paperwork for both lenders and brokers," said Richard Ward, President of Affinity Corporation. In addition to adding features to each other's products, Affinity and LION will conduct joint marketing, research and training activities to support the product tie-ins and link to each other's web site.
